  • Abstract
    This paper discusses the problem of ranking technical requirements (TRs) according to customer needs (CNs), which is arisen from the final stage of the house of quality (HOQ) process. To rank technical requirements in a useful approach, the paper employs an integrated analytic hierarchy process (AHP) and PROMETHEE II approach; AHP is used to determine the relative importance of multicriteria, and PROMETHEE II is applied for final ranking of technical requirements. To analyze the quality and reliability of decision problem, the result of PROMETHEE II evaluation is represented by the geometrical analysis for interactive aid (GAIA) plane. A case study on an automotive part is put forward to illustrate the performance of the proposed methodology.
